Uncanny Effects: Robert Giard's Currents of Connection

Jan 22 – Apr 19, 2020
26 Wooster St, New York, NY 10013, United States

The rebellious photographer Robert Giard was best known for his portraits of members of the LGBTQ+ community. He took pictures of writers and creatives, advocating for them during a time when they were often shunned. But many people don’t know that Giard’s practice extended way beyond portraiture. In an exhibition that showcases the lesser known aspects of his oeuvre, Giard’s striking landscape photographs, still lifes, and nudes are also on display. —E.C.
